Associate Professor Andy Song is affiliated with the School of Computing Technologies at RMIT University, Australia. His research focuses on Artificial Intelligence, Image Processing, Machine Learning, Distributed Computing, and Applied Mathematics. He leads projects such as developing AI-driven circular economy solutions for waste management and obstacle detection systems for the visually impaired.
Research interests include energy-efficient AI models, explainable deep learning, and optimization algorithms. His work bridges theoretical advancements with practical applications, such as smart wearables and healthcare scheduling systems. Supervised projects span fields like neural architecture search, cybersecurity, and urban infrastructure optimization.
Publications emphasize interdisciplinary approaches, combining computer vision, optimization, and sustainability. He collaborates on projects addressing real-world challenges in healthcare, environmental science, and assistive technologies.
